pandas.DataFrame excludes specific rows

If we want to filter only one or certain rows like Excel, we can use isin( ) method, pass in the values ​​of the required rows in a list, you can also pass in a dictionary and specify columns for filtering.

But if we only want all content that does not contain a specific line, there is no isnotin() method. I encountered such a requirement at work today. After searching frequently, I found that I could only use isin() in another way to achieve this requirement.

The example is as follows:

In [3]: df = pd.DataFrame([['GD', 'GX', 'FJ'], ['SD', 'SX', 'BJ'], ['HN', 'HB'
 ...: , 'AH'], ['HEN', 'HEN', 'HLJ'], ['SH', 'TJ', 'CQ']], columns=['p1', 'p2
 ...: ', 'p3'])

In [4]: df
Out[4]:
 p1 p2 p3
0 GD GX FJ
1 SD SX BJ
2 HN HB AH
3 HEN HEN HLJ
4 SH TJ CQ

If you only want the two rows where p1 is GD and HN, you can do this:

In [8]: df[df.p1.isin(['GD', 'HN'])]
Out[8]:
 p1 p2 p3
0 GD GX FJ
2 HN HB AH

But if we want To get data other than these two rows, you need to take a detour.

The principle is to first take out p1 and convert it into a list, then remove unnecessary rows (values) from the list, and then use isin() in the DataFrame

In [9]: ex_list = list(df.p1)

In [10]: ex_list.remove('GD')

In [11]: ex_list.remove('HN')

In [12]: ex_list
Out[12]: ['SD', 'HEN', 'SH']

In [13]: df[df.p1.isin(ex_list)]
Out[13]:
 p1 p2 p3
1 SD SX BJ
3 HEN HEN HLJ
4 SH TJ CQ
